Hi Kristal, can you talk to us a bit about the social impact of your business?
I love giving back to fellow music fans who have helped my social accounts and online blog become what they are – whether it’s free concert tickets, Ticketmaster gift cards, or a merchandise item from their favorite artist.

The other week, I received a direct message from a winner of a pair of concert tickets. She won the giveaway in the Fall, but her show wasn’t until March. Unbeknownst to me, she lost a loved one around the time I randomly selected her, and the concert was her first outing because the grieving process had been so hard. Music has the power to bring us all together in the most beautiful ways, and I’m grateful I have the opportunity to shine a little light in people’s lives.

Let’s talk shop? Tell us more about your career, what can you share with our community?
I’m a multi-hyphenate. My 9 to 5 consists of me working on the social side of MTV – managing social media accounts for some of the biggest fan-voted award shows like the Video Music Awards and EMAs. My 5 to 9 is running my blog NOLA Concerts, which includes photographing, reviewing, and posting on socials. Additionally, in the last year, I’ve begun building my brand (@kristalterrell) on TikTok, YouTube, and Instagram.

My biggest challenges are work/life balance and time management. The last year has included a lot of trial and error, but I’ve learned to find a flow that works for me that doesn’t leave me feeling drained. I’ve learned to give myself grace and to be proactive vs reactive when possible. Also, it’s okay to not do everything – it’s okay to turn down paid partnerships or giveaway opportunities!

Let’s say your best friend was visiting the area and you wanted to show them the best time ever. Where would you take them? Give us a little itinerary – say it was a week long trip, where would you eat, drink, visit, hang out, etc.
I currently live in New Orleans but love visiting Los Angeles and always share my favorite recommendations with others. I love trying new coffee shops, and some of my favorites in LA are La La Land Kind Cafe, Alfred Coffee, and Alfalfa. I also love visiting iconic music sites in different cities, so LA must stops are pictures outside of Capitol Records, visiting the GRAMMY Museum, a show at one of LA’s iconic music venues like the Hollywood Bowl, shopping at Amoeba Music, and walking along the Hollywood Walk of Fame.
